Psalmotoxin 1 (PcTx1) is a protein toxin that can bind at subunit-subunit interfaces of acid-sensing ion channel 1a (ASIC1a). Psalmotoxin 1 is a potent and slective ASIC1a inhibitor (IC50: 0.9 nM) by increasing the apparent affinity for H + of ASIC1a. Psalmotoxin 1 can induce cell apoptosis, also inhibits cell migration, proferliration and invasion of cancer cells. Psalmotoxin 1 can be used in the research of cancers, or neurological disease .

ASIC1a antagonist-1 (Compound 5b) is an orthosteric noncompetitive Acid sensing ion channels 1a (ASIC1a) antagonist with an IC50 of 27 nM (pH 6.7). ASIC1a antagonist-1 shifts pH dependence of ASIC1a activation and inhibits its maximal evoked response. ASIC1a antagonist-1 completely inhibits long-term potentiation (LTP) induction in CA3-CA1 pathway. ASIC1a antagonist-1 can be used for brain diseases and pathologies research .

N-Methylhistamine dihydrochloride (Nα-Methylhistamine dihydrochloride) is a non-selective Histamine receptor agonist. N-Methylhistamine dihydrochloride activates histamine H1, H2 and H3 receptors; it stimulates central H1 receptors by activating sympathetic α and β adrenergic receptors to inhibit intestinal transit, exerts dose-dependent inhibition on intestinal transit, reduces histamine turnover in mouse brains, and increases gastric acid secretion without altering plasma gastrin concentrations. N-Methylhistamine dihydrochloride produces a pH-dependent, voltage-independent potentiating effect on acid-sensing ion channel 1a, and shows no significant activity toward homologous ASIC2a channels. N-Methylhistamine dihydrochloride can be used in studies related to Helicobacter pylori infection .

π-TRTX-Hm3a is a 37-amino acid peptide isolated from Togo starburst tarantula (Heteroscodra maculata) venom. π-TRTX-Hm3a pH-dependently inhibits acid-sensing ion channel 1a (ASIC1a) with an IC50 of 1-2 nM and potentiates ASIC1b with an EC50 of 46.5 nM .
